> This looks very generic, setting and clearing bits in bytesized
> registers.
>
> Can you please attempt to use generic GPIO for this?
>
Linus,
I looked into it, but for my part I seem to be missing how the generic GPIO code
permits locking access to the hardware (PLD) and setting the PLD's page register.
In other words, I don't immediately see how to call kempld_get_mutex_set_index()
from the generic GPIO code. The other drivers using generic GPIO code don't
seem to have that requirement.
